When it comes to ensuring the longevity and durability of swimming pools, using high-quality waterproofing materials is essential. 2-part polymer epoxy is a popular choice for pool coatings due to its fire and water-resistant properties. This innovative material provides excellent protection against water damage, chemicals, and UV exposure, making it an ideal solution for maintaining a pristine swimming pool.
The 2-part polymer epoxy consists of two components that are mixed together to create a strong and durable coating. This type of coating forms a seamless barrier that prevents water from seeping into the pool's structure, protecting it from leaks and cracks. Additionally, the fire-resistant properties of 2-part polymer epoxy make it a safe choice for pool areas, reducing the risk of fire damage.
One of the key benefits of using 2-part polymer epoxy for swimming pool coatings is its water-proof nature. This material is specifically designed to withstand constant exposure to water and chemicals, making it perfect for pool environments. Its waterproofing properties create a long-lasting barrier that prevents water penetration and ensures the structural integrity of the pool.
Another advantage of 2-part polymer epoxy is its resistance to UV radiation. Prolonged exposure to sunlight can cause damage to traditional pool coatings, leading to discoloration and deterioration. However, 2-part polymer epoxy is UV-resistant, protecting the pool's surface from fading and maintaining its aesthetic appeal over time.
Furthermore, 2-part polymer epoxy coatings are easy to apply and require minimal maintenance. Once the two components are mixed, the coating can be easily spread over the pool surface, creating a smooth and uniform finish. Its low maintenance requirements make it a cost-effective solution for pool owners looking to enhance the longevity of their pool.
